BA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

2,483 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Boeing (BA)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$105B — up 46% from $72.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 442 funds opened new BA positions and 121 closed out — a net gain of 321 holders — while 821 added to existing stakes and 881 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$2.07B. The largest seller was Point72 Asset Management, cutting an estimated $218M.
